Frequently Asked Questions

Which is better, AAdvantage Aviator Red or Citi AAdvantage Platinum Select?

The Citi AAdvantage Platinum Select offers a higher sign-up bonus value (80,000 miles vs 60,000 miles). However, the best choice depends on your spending habits, travel preferences, and whether the annual fee is worth it for your situation.

Can I have both the AAdvantage Aviator Red and Citi AAdvantage Platinum Select?

Yes, since the AAdvantage Aviator Red is issued by Barclays and the Citi AAdvantage Platinum Select is issued by Citi, you can apply for and hold both cards simultaneously.
